Understanding Laser Cleaning Technology

Laser cleaning is an advanced surface treatment technology that uses laser beams to remove contaminants, rust, coatings, and debris from various materials. Unlike traditional cleaning methods, laser cleaning is non-abrasive, does not use harmful chemicals, and is ideal for precise cleaning without damaging the surface beneath. It works by focusing a high-intensity laser onto the surface of the material. The laser energy is absorbed by the contaminants or rust, which causes them to evaporate or be blown away, leaving the underlying material clean.

Laser cleaning technology is being adopted across various industries due to its effectiveness, precision, and environmental friendliness. Whether you are in the manufacturing, automotive, aerospace, or heritage restoration sectors, the demand for laser cleaning machines is growing. How to Choose the Right Laser Cleaning Machine for Your Needs

Choosing the right laser cleaning machine requires careful consideration of several factors. The quality, performance, and overall value of the machine depend on these aspects. Below are some crucial points to evaluate before you decide to make a purchase:

  1. Application Type
    The first step in selecting a laser cleaning machine is to determine the type of application. Laser cleaning can be used for various purposes, including rust removal, paint stripping, surface preparation, and even cleaning intricate parts in sensitive industries like aerospace. Depending on the material you are working with and the kind of cleaning you need, the specifications and power of the laser cleaning machine will vary.

For instance, a machine for rust removal will require higher power and a more robust system compared to one used for delicate artwork restoration. Additionally, certain materials may require specific wavelengths or pulsed lasers, so it’s essential to choose a machine tailored to your exact needs.

  1. Laser Power and Type
    Laser cleaning machines come in different power capacities. For most applications, machines range from low-power units (100W to 500W) to high-power units (1kW to 4kW or more). Higher power is typically required for industrial applications that involve heavy rust or coating removal, while lower power machines are ideal for lighter cleaning tasks like removing dirt or delicate contaminants.

There are also different types of lasers used in these machines, such as fiber lasers, CO2 lasers, and pulsed lasers. Each type of laser has its own strengths, and choosing the right one depends on your specific needs. Fiber lasers, for example, are known for their efficiency and precision in cleaning metals, while CO2 lasers are effective for organic material cleaning.

  1. Portability
    Portability is an essential factor, especially if you need to move the cleaning equipment around your workspace or take it to different sites. Some laser cleaning machines come with handheld options, allowing operators to focus on specific spots that require cleaning. Handheld machines are typically smaller, lighter, and more flexible, but they might be less powerful than their larger, stationary counterparts.

On the other hand, if you’re working in a fixed location, a stationary laser cleaning machine might be a more efficient solution, particularly for large-scale industrial applications.

  3. Budget Considerations
    When searching for a laser cleaning machine for sale, the price is a significant factor. You need to balance the upfront cost of purchasing the machine with long-term operational costs. Laser cleaning machines are an investment, and choosing the right one is important to ensure you get the best return on your investment.

Be sure to ask about ongoing maintenance costs, the lifespan of consumables (like lenses), and any service contracts that may be necessary. While the initial purchase price is a key factor, the machine's operating efficiency, longevity, and the support provided will determine its true value.
